WPI 3293 Pill: white, capsule/oblong
The pill with imprint WPI 3293 (White, Capsule/Oblong, 0mm) has been identified as Telmisartan 40 mg and is used for High Blood Pressure, Prevention of Cardiovascular Disease, and Cardiovascular Risk Reduction. It belongs to the drug class angiotensin receptor blockers and is not a controlled substance.
